MEMO — Closure of the Harwick Lane Office

To the incoming director: Dunmore Analytics will close its four-person Harwick Lane office at the end of next quarter. Staff have been offered relocation to the Veldon site; two have accepted. Lease exit costs are modest and budgeted. Client coverage transfers to the regional team. Context on the wider plan is in the confidential note below.

management briefing: Project Juleth slips by two quarters because of the audit delay.

## Formula sandbox tuning

User-supplied formulas in Gridmoor execute inside a restricted interpreter with hard ceilings on time, memory, and call depth. Reviewers should confirm any change to these ceilings is justified in the PR description, since raising them widens the abuse surface. Defaults were chosen from production traces. The current limits are as follows.

limits module of tafog-fawip:
WEIGHTS = {
    "julix": 57,
    "lamys": 992,
    "kasvan": 209,
    "quenok": 750,
    "alddor": 259,
    "oliath": 1009,
    "wenix": 815,
}

Handover: Tilewarden prefetcher

Runs on the two Ostbron workers, cron every 20 min. It walks the viewport heatmap from Cartofex and pre-pulls tiles two zoom levels down. Don't touch the eviction logic — Priya rewrote it last sprint and it's fragile. Logs go to the usual sink. Everything it needs at startup is listed below.

config for kagup-hahig:
druwyn:
  pin: 2801
  metrics_host: metrics.druwyn.zemvarlabs.internal
  tenant: sorius
  seal: seal_798a43d7